技术文摘
Rust 连续七年称霸“最受推崇语言”:从电梯故障到编程新宠
2024-12-30 16:11:43 小编
Rust 连续七年称霸“最受推崇语言”:从电梯故障到编程新宠
在编程语言的广袤世界中,Rust 犹如一颗璀璨的明星,连续七年稳坐“最受推崇语言”的宝座。这一成就并非偶然,而是源于其独特的魅力和卓越的性能。
Rust 的崛起可以追溯到开发者对于高效、安全和可靠编程的不懈追求。曾经,在编程领域中,类似于电梯故障这样的严重问题,往往是由于代码的漏洞和错误导致的。而 Rust 的出现,就像是为这个混乱的世界带来了秩序和保障。
它以其严格的内存安全机制而闻名。在传统的编程语言中,内存管理错误常常导致程序崩溃、数据泄露等严重后果。但 Rust 通过其创新的所有权和借用系统,从根本上杜绝了这类问题,为程序的稳定运行提供了坚实的基础。
Rust 的性能也是其备受青睐的重要原因之一。它能够在不牺牲安全性的前提下,提供与 C 和 C++ 相媲美的高效执行速度。这使得它在对性能要求极高的领域,如系统编程、Web 服务等,都有着出色的表现。
不仅如此,Rust 还拥有活跃而充满激情的社区。开发者们在这个社区中分享经验、交流心得,共同推动 Rust 的发展。丰富的库和工具生态也使得开发变得更加便捷和高效。
随着技术的不断进步,Rust 的应用范围也在不断扩大。从云计算到人工智能,从区块链到物联网,Rust 正在各个领域展现其强大的能力。
然而,Rust 的学习曲线相对陡峭,这对于初学者来说可能是一个挑战。但正是这种挑战,也吸引了众多热爱技术、追求卓越的开发者投身其中,不断探索和创新。
Rust 连续七年称霸“最受推崇语言”实至名归。它不仅解决了编程中的诸多难题,还为未来的软件开发指明了方向。相信在未来的日子里,Rust 将继续引领编程世界的潮流,创造更多的辉煌。
- 从未有人将 Flink 讲解得如此透彻
- 你知晓负载均衡的5种算法中的几种?
- 适用于 Debian 体系的本地安装 DEB 包的 3 种命令行工具
- Python 找工作,没那么简单,该清醒了
- 中科院软件所推出我国首个量子程序设计平台
- 华为开发 HMS 获 45000 个 APP 支持 替代谷歌 GMS
- Gource:版本控制的可视化神器,操作简单效果佳如烟花秀
- 2019 年 22 款热门的软件开发工具
- 10 行代码打造群聊提醒神器,不再错过任何消息
- 13 款免费的 API 设计、开发与测试工具
- 不会 Java 多线程优化,怎能拿下 Offer ?
- 你选对生成随机数的方式了吗?
- 常见的 7 个 Html5 开发框架
- 20 元打造运行 Linux 和 Python 的名片
- 微服务架构的大火之详解与实践